Output b49f992dcec7414e10fd1db04492c8664d6b206ddb313d9b9cc2990f72678f01:29

value
19745854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c343bb66dcd2e4e81c555086d78184552eea0b OP_EQUAL
address
3KzYz8XYUh4hBRuKA37VzgyavubY2iez6c
transaction
b49f992dcec7414e10fd1db04492c8664d6b206ddb313d9b9cc2990f72678f01
confirmations
286884
spent
true